> and then there are sounds that have their own "natural" length. my
> kawai k5000 which does additive and wavetable synthesis has quite a
> few patches that have "natural" decay/release curves built into the
> patch. a note off does nothing but terminate the sound early. if you
> don't send a note off, the voice will still decay, but it will hog one
> of the available voice slots.
